\(3(t-3)=5(2t+1)\)
\(\Rightarrow\) \(3t - 9 = 10t + 5\) (Opening the brackets)
\(\Rightarrow\) \(- 9 - 5 = 10t - 3t\)
\(\Rightarrow\) \(- 14 = 7t \)
\(\Rightarrow\) \(t = \frac{-14}{7}\)
\(\Rightarrow\) \(t = -2\)
